Question 802
Which one of the following statements about normal forms is FALSE?
A
BCNF is stricter than 3NF
B
Lossless,dependency preserving decomposition into BCNF is always possible
C
Lossless,dependency preserving decomposition into 3NF is always possible
D
Any relation with two attributes is BCNF
Question 802 Explanation: 
Option A​ : BCNF is stricter than 3NF. In this all redundancy based on functional dependency has been removed.
Option B​ : Lossless, dependency preserving decomposition into 3NF is always possible.
Option C​ : It is false.
It is not possible to have dependency preserving in BCNF decomposition.
→ Let take an example, 3NF can’t be decomposed into BCNF.
Option D​ : It is true.
Let consider two attributes (X, Y).
If (X→Y), X is a candidate key. It is in BCNF and vice-versa.
Correct Answer: B
